TY - JOUR AU - Lee, Shiang-Ting AU - Huang, Wen-Lii PY - 2013 DA - 2013/08/13 TI - Cytokinin, auxin, and abscisic acid affects sucrose metabolism conduce to de novo shoot organogenesis in rice (Oryza sativa L.) callus JO - Botanical Studies SP - 5 VL - 54 IS - 1 AB - Shoot regeneration frequency in rice callus is still low and highly diverse among rice cultivars. This study aimed to investigate the association of plant hormone signaling and sucrose uptake and metabolism in rice during callus induction and early shoot organogenesis. The immatured seeds of two rice cultivars, Ai-Nan-Tsao 39 (ANT39) and Tainan 11 (TN11) are used in this study.
